WikiScrapper

What is it?

Assuming the user is at the Wikipedia article for Wild Yak​ .

What’s the lowest number of clicks to get to the article for the ​ Phil McGraw​ ?

Acceptance Criteria

  • Write a program that can take the URLs of two Wikipedia pages and output the minimum number of clicks to get from one to the other.

  • Your program should be runnable one the command line like this: $ my_program ‘Wild yak’ ‘Phil McGraw’

  • The program’s output should include each link that needs to be clicked to reach the final destination of Phil McGraw.

Implementation strategy

Our solution will use Python and Bash with cli serving as the interface to produce the results. Work will be done as a collective using slack as a medium of communication and git as a means of hosting and testing against the use case.

Technical Challenges

  • Navigating to the page and generating the proper link to the end page
  • Scrapping all active links on pages and storing them
  • Optimization of use case and performance
